Its so nice to see these guys still producing Albums and being out and about. I had been so used to hearing "Clear Blue Flame" and rocking out to them. This album for me really gave me a much better impression of their talents. They are substantially more versatile and really show it off on this album in my opinion. I think it is a little more bluesy than previous albums, with a little more acoustic guitar on some tunes as well. Pretty solid overall, and check out tracks 3 and 5 for my favorites.
